This 3 m high wayside cross made of sandstone is a donation from Pastor Johannes Schaller, the long-time pastor of the Catholic parish of St. Martin in Ludwigshafen-Oppau. It stands on a spider in the fields and walking paths between the Ludwigshafen districts of Oppau and Friesenheim - together with two rest benches.A small plaque (on the left side of the cross) indicates that Pastor Schaller donated this wayside cross in April 1998. At that time he was priest for 40 years, pastor of St. Martin in LU-Oppau for 25 years and vice dean of the Ludwigshafen city church for 20 years.The regional press ("Mannheimer Morgen" dated November 2nd, 2009) shows that Pastor Schaller was very popular with his "little sheep". He died in 2009 at the age of 78.
